Formato para prácticas de laboratorio - yaqui.mxl.uabc....

Click here to load reader

  • date post

    04-Oct-2018
  • Category

    Documents

  • view

    215
  • download

    0

Embed Size (px)

Transcript of Formato para prácticas de laboratorio - yaqui.mxl.uabc....

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    CARRERA PLAN DE ESTUDIOCLAVE

    ASIGNATURA NOMBRE DE LA ASIGNATURA

    IC 20031 5046 BasesdeDatos

    PRCTICA No.

    LABORATORIO DE BasesdeDatos

    DURACIN(HORA)

    4 NOMBRE DE LA PRCTICA IntroduccinalaAdministracindeMySQL 2

    1. INTRODUCCIN

    Uno de los manejadores de bases de datos que se utilizar durante este curso es el manejador MySQL. Este manejador aun cuando esta disponible de manera gratuita, resulta ser poderoso y de existen actualmente muchas empresas que lo utilizan para almacenar su informacin.

    2. OBJETIVO (COMPETENCIA)

    Al finalizar esta practica se tendran los conocimientos para la administracin demostrativa, se conocer la forma de instalar MySQL tanto en el sistema operativo Windows como en Linux. Adicionalmente se conocer la forma de trabajar con el MySQL desde la consola de administracin para hacer consultas. Finalmente se visitarn algunos sitios a los que se puede recurrir cuando se tienen dudas sobre MySQL.

    Formul

    Nayely Amaro Ortega

    Revis

    M.C. Gloria E. Chavez Valenzuela

    Aprob Autoriz

    M.C. Miguel ngel Martnez Romero

    Maestro Coordinador de la CarreraGestin de la

    CalidadDirector de la

    Facultad

    Cdigo GC-N4-017 .Pgina 1 de 14 Revisin 1 .

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    3. FUNDAMENTO

    El manejador de bases de datos MySQL puede instalarse tanto en la plataforma de Windows como en la de Linux y otros sistemas operativos. En esta practica se har una demostracin del proceso de instalacin en ambos sistemas operativos.

    Instalacin en Windows

    Para realizar la instalacin de MySQL en Windows, es necesario contar con el archivo de instalacion de MySQL que puede descargarse del sitio de MySQL. El archivo para esta

    demostracin es: mysqlessential4.1.14win32.msi y el proceso de instalacin se

    describe a continuacin.

    Proceso de instalacin

    1. Descargar el archivo mysqlessential4.1.14win32.msi (Este se puede descargar

    del sitio de MySQL http://dev.mysql.com/downloads/mysql/4.1.html).2. Haga doble-click en el archivo que se descarg.3. Siga las indicaciones de instalacin.4. La ultima pantalla de instalacin tendr un checkbox donde pregunta si quiere

    configurar en ese momento el servidor, seleccionelo.5. Iniciar el asistente para la configuracin del servidor.6. Acepte la configuracin detallada y presione next.7. Indique que el tipo de maquina ser developer machine y presione next.8. Acepte la opcin Multifunctional Database y presione next.9. Acepte los valores por default para la ubicacin de la base de datos y presione next.10.Acepte 20 conexiones simultaneas por default y presione next.11.Habilite TCP/IP Networking aceptando el puerto 3306 y presione next.

    Cdigo GC-N4-017 .Pgina 2 de 14 Revisin 1 .

    http://dev.mysql.com/downloads/mysql/4.1.htmlhttp://dev.mysql.com/downloads/mysql/4.1.htmlhttp://dev.mysql.com/downloads/mysql/4.1.html

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    12.Acepte el conjunto de caracteres default y presione next.13.Acepte que se instale MySQL como un servicio de windows y que se lance

    automaticamente al cargar Windows. Si no lo quiere como servicio, lo deber levantar el servicio manualmente cada vez que quiera trabajar con la base de datos.

    14.Tambien seleccione la opcin Include bin Directory in windows PATH para que pueda correr los ejecutables desde la lnea de mandos. Presione next.

    15.Ahora debe escribir el password de root. Anotelo y no lo olvide.16.Cree tambien una cuenta anonima ya que su servidor ser para aprendizaje.17.Presione Execute e iniciar la configuracin. Cuando termine, presione Finish.

    Instalacin en Linux

    El proceso de instalacin de MySQL en el sistema operativo Linux puede variar dependiendo del tipo de archivo que descargue. El mas fcil de instalar es el tipo RPM (originalmente RPM significaba Red Hat Package Manger). En el sitio de MySQL

    podemos encontrar un RPM para el servidor (MySQLserver4.0.260.i386.rpm), otro

    para el cliente (MySQLclient4.0.260.i386.rpm) y algunos otros para el desarrollo

    de aplicaciones.

    El otro tipo de archivo que se puede descargar es aquel con terminacin tar.gz por

    ejemplo (mysqlstandard4.0.26pclinuxgnui686.tar.gz). Este tipo de archivo

    primero debe descomprimirse y desempaquetarse antes de poderse instalar. En algunos casos contiene el cdigo fuente de la aplicacin por lo que deber configurarse y despus compilarse. En otros casos no ser necesario compilar y bastar con mover el directorio que se creo al desempaquetarse al directorio final de MySQL. Usualmente los archivos tar.gz contienen algn tipo de archivo de ayuda o README que indica el procedimiento que deber seguirse para la instalacin del software deseado.

    Cdigo GC-N4-017 .Pgina 3 de 14 Revisin 1 .

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    Por otra parte, la mayora de las distribuciones de Linux ya incluyen MySQL como un de los paquetes standard. En este caso, la instalacin de MySQL depender de la distribucin que se este manejando. A continuacin se describe el proceso que se seguira con la distribucin Mandriva (antes Mandrake).

    Proceso de instalacin

    1. Abrir el instalador de paquetes seleccionando del menu principal System-Configuration-Packaging-Install Software.

    2. Escriba la contrasea de root cuando le sea solicitada.3. Cuando aparezca la ventana del instalador, escriba mysql en el rea de texto para

    que bsque todos los paquetes relacionados. Seleccione todos los paquetes como se indica en la Figura 1. En ocaciones, al seleccionar el primer paquete, se detectar que la instalacin de este depender de la instalacin de otros paquetes y aparecer una ventana indicando esto. En esta ventana se puede indicar que se desea que se instalen todos los paquetes necesarios para resolver las dependencias.

    Cdigo GC-N4-017 .Pgina 4 de 14 Revisin 1 .

    Figura 1: Instalador de paquetes.

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    4. Una vez seleccionados todos los paquetes que se desean instalar, presione el botn Install y proceder la instalacin. Durante la instalacin, el programa solicitar que inserte el CD que contenga los paquete que va requiriendo.

    5. Una vez terminada la instalacin, cierre la ventana del instalador.6. Para verificar que el servidor MySQL este levantado y que se va a levantar cada vez

    que se encienda la mquina, se debe consultar el listado de servicios. Esto se pude acceder desde el menu principal seleccionando System-Configuration-Configure your computer. Una vez que se escribe la contrasea de root, seleccionar System en el Control Center.

    7. Seleccionar el icono correspondiente a servicios Figura 2.

    8. Aparecer un listado con todos los servicios disponibles en el sistema. Ahi deber buscar el servicio del servidor MySQL y activarlo y si lo desea indicar que este debe levantarse cada vez que se reinicie el servidor. La Figura 3 muestra un listado parcial de servicios.

    Cdigo GC-N4-017 .Pgina 5 de 14 Revisin 1 .

    Figura 2: Configuracin de Servicios

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    Administracin de MySQLDentro de la administracion de MySQL las operaciones que podemos realizar sobre los usuarios son:

    Crear usuario Asignar Password

    Renombar usuario Borrar usuario Otorgar y revocar permisos a usuario

    Crear UsuarioEste comando crea nuevas cuentas MySQL. Para usarlas, debe tener el permiso global CREATE USER o el permiso INSERT para la base de datos mysql . Para cada cuenta, CREATE USER crea un nuevo registro en la tabla mysql.user que no tiene permisos. Un error ocurre si la cuenta ya existe

    Cdigo GC-N4-017 .Pgina 6 de 14 Revisin 1 .

    Figura 3: Administracin de servicios

  • Fecha de efectividad: __________________

    UNIVERSIDAD AUTNOMA DE BAJA CALIFORNIAFACULTAD DE INGENIERA (UNIDAD MEXICALI)

    DOCUMENTO DEL SISTEMA DE CALIDAD

    Formato para prcticas de laboratorio

    Asignar PasswordEl comando SET PASSWORD asigna una contrasea a una cuenta de usuario MySQL existente.

    Renombrar UsuarioEl comando RENAME USER renombra cuentas de usuario MySQL existentes. Para usarlo, debe tener el permiso CREATE USER global o el permiso UPDATE para la base de datos mysql . Ocurre un error si cualquier